Chapter 58 Summary

Aboard Kang's ship, they noticed that the platform is tilting, but do not feel it is tilting enough to be concerned. In fact, the platform is only tilted 3°, and the rocket can handle a 5° differential and still be successful. In the Badger, Dirks aggressive solution is seriously damaging the submersible, and Dirk risks drowning and electrocution, while he continues his assault.
